Abstract
Some aspects of modeling of overtravel that is observed in rotor-type electric machine units are examined. Methods are proposed for determining the physical and engineering parameters of those units. The maximum effect from the results of the work could be obtained by using them to supplement the traditional methods of using products under actual conditions.
